SUBMITTED BY: Michael Morales, Dept. of Community and Economic Development CONTACT: Michael Morales, 575 -3533 SUMMARY EXPLANATION: The Yakima County SIED fund provides 100% grants for planning activities related to capital improvement projects that create economic development activity. The Department of Community and Economic Development requests authorization to submit a $25,000 planning grant application for the following activities: • Community mobilization and visioning process to determine options for infrastructure and public facilities related to the North 1 Street Corridor Revitalization Project. • Develop illustrations and cost estimates for recommended improvements. R-2010- A RESOLUTION authorizing the City Manager to execute and submit a planning grant application and related documents in the amount of $25,000 to the Yakima County Supporting Investments in Economic Diversification fund for transportation and public facilities planning related to the North 1s Street Corridor Revitalization Project. WHEREAS, Yakima County has established. the Supporting Investments in Economic Diversification (SIED) fund to assist the growth of•business in the County; and WHEREAS, economic development is a priority for the City of Yakima, and the City intends to approach economic development on an inclusive, comprehensive basis which involves public, private and community -based efforts to achieve new investment and . redevelopment in the City; and WHEREAS, regional cooperation is an important part of our economic development efforts; and WHEREAS, the North 1st Street Corridor Revitalization Project is a high priority economic development initiative of the City Council; and WHEREAS, the Yakima City Council, the Greater Yakima Chamber of Commerce and the business and property owners of the North 1s Street Corridor have determined that streetscape and infrastructure improvements are necessary for future economic development activities in the area; and WHEREAS, analysis of options for the location of infrastructure and public facilities within the redevelopment area will be a necessary component of the overall planning process; and WHEREAS, funding (through a grant) may be available from Yakima County through the SIED Fund for planning activities related to the project's development; and WHEREAS, the City Council deems it to be in the best interest of the City of Yakima to authorize submittal of a grant application with Yakima County for funding of said planning activities from the SIED Fund, now, therefore,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F YAKIMA: The City Manager is authorized to execute and submit a planning grant application and related documents in the amount of . $25,000 to the Yakima County Supporting Investments in Economic Diversification fund for transportation and public facilities planning related to the North 1st Street Corridor Revitalization Project. The Yakima City Manager is hereby designated as the official representative of the City to act in connection with that funding application and is authorized to take such additional actions as may be necessary and prudent to complete the project.
